* iio: Add helper functions for enum style channel attributesLars-Peter Clausen2012-06-051-0/+64
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| We often have the case were we do have a enum style channel attribute. These attributes have in common that they are a list of string values which usually map in a 1-to-1 fashion to integer values. This patch implements some common helper code for implementing enum style channel attributes using extended channel attributes. The helper functions take care of converting between the string and integer values, as well providing a function for "_available" attributes which list all available enum items. * iio: Add dev_to_iio_dev() helper functionLars-Peter Clausen2012-05-141-0/+11
| | | | | | | | | | | | | This patch adds a helper function for retriving a iio_dev struct from a device struct. Currently we open-code this in two different ways. One is using dev_get_drvdata on the device and the other is using container_of. The new helper function uses the container_of solution as it creates slightly smaller code and also will eventually free up the drvdata pointer for usage by invidual drivers. * staging:iio: Streamline API function namingLars-Peter Clausen2012-04-291-6/+6
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Currently we use two different naming schemes in the IIO API, iio_verb_object and iio_object_verb. E.g iio_device_register and iio_allocate_device. This patches renames instances of the later to the former. The patch also renames allocate to alloc as this seems to be the preferred form throughout the kernel.
